Kittens of Mass Destruction

The other morning, I heard an unusual rustling coming from the kitten room. I went in to investigate, and caught some naughty kittens in the act.

I had left their little kitten climber too close to the table I had set up our little telethon set on. Betty and Marie-Noire had climbed up there, got on the table, and were trashing the joint. I'm not sure they were the only ones responsible for the mess because the others weren't too far away, involved in similar merriment.

The tiny chairs were turned over, tote board numbers with teeth marks were on the ground, the telephones were strewn about. One kitten was behind the curtain and batting at the other on the other side.

I got there just in the nick of time. It seemed it was only a matter of moments before the walls would be literally coming down.

Naturally, I grabbed my camera to document the mad scene.

After a few pictures, I plucked the kittens from the set. I had to laugh, Betty had a number two stuck to her foot. Not a number two as in poo, but an actual number two from the tote board.

No major harm done, no one got hurt, and I got a few pictures...
